Designing for a Net-Zero Future: System Strategies

Achieving net-zero emissions necessitates a comprehensive and integrated approach to system design. This entails a paradigm shift focused on sustainable practices across all sectors, from energy production and consumption to industrial processes and transportation. A successful net-zero roadmap must utilize cutting-edge technologies, implement policy regulations, and empower stakeholders at all levels.

  • Essential considerations in system design for decarbonization include:
  • Optimizing energy efficiency across sectors
  • Shifting to renewable energy sources and smart grid development
  • Decarbonizing industrial processes through innovation
  • Electrifying electric mobility and transportation systems
  • Implementing sustainable land use practices and carbon sequestration solutions

In conclusion, a successful net-zero roadmap requires a holistic system design approach that meets the complexities of decarbonization across all facets of our society.
